Graham wins CARQUEST Series race at Peterborough Speedway

PETERBOROUGH, ON - On Saturday night, the CASCAR CARQUEST Series made its 
lone appearance of the season at Peterborough Speedway for the CARQUEST 
100. Series points leader Brad Graham added to his championship lead with a 
dominant performance at the high-banked, 1/3-mile Peterborough oval. The HB 
Material Handling Dodge driver earned the top starting position during 
qualifying and led all 100 laps of the feature race.
	Second-place went to Jason Hathaway, of Appin, ON. The E.L. Fordham / TSC 
Stores Chevy racer dogged Graham for the first half of the event, but 
backed off a bit, at mid-distance, in preparation for a final charge. 
Hathaway was all over the leader for the final 10 laps, but couldn't make 
the winning pass on Graham, who collected his second checkered flag of the 
season. Hathaway also has a pair of CARQUEST Series victories in '04.
	Third-place at Peterborough went to veteran racer Mike Hryniuk, driver of 
the One Stop Auto Pontiac. The LaSalle, ON racer started fourth in the 
field of 18 at Peterborough.
	The seventh and final CARQUEST Series race of the season takes place next 
Saturday, Sept. 18 at Kawartha Speedway as part of the CASCAR Championship 
weekend.
